Legged Robots Face a Wider Reality Check
Single-source brief: A new review maps progress and open gaps, not a product launch.
What Changed
A review titled Advances, challenges, and opportunities for legged robots is now listed by arXiv.
The work covers humanoid and four-legged robots. It assesses their current capabilities across hardware, movement, autonomy, data, and uses.
According to arXiv, the paper was published in Science Robotics on July 29, 2026.
The authors frame legged robots as systems that could affect work, human interaction, and scientific research.
Deployment Reality
This is a research review, not a field deployment report.
It does not identify a specific robot, customer site, runtime, payload, or uptime result.
It also does not show that any humanoid has cleared the full path to broad use.
For operators, that distinction matters. A robot can walk well in a demo while still lacking safe autonomy, useful data, or reliable hardware.
The Engineering Gaps
The review points to open challenges across hardware, locomotion, autonomy, data, and applications.
Those areas link together in real deployments. Better walking alone does not solve task planning. Strong autonomy alone does not fix weak hardware.
The paper also considers ethical, economic, and policy issues. Those factors can shape where legged robots are used.
